I flew with these some years ago from Pafos

http://www.griffonaviation.com/

Aeroplane was a PA28, tatty looking but fully serviceable. It gets very bumpy due to thermal activity and you have mountains rising straight off the sea. You wouldn't want a forced landing I can tell you.

Chart was a photocopy and you needed a FP for every flight.

No idea what they are like now but if they're still in business they must have something going for them.
